NAME

       theme-d-compile - the Theme-D compiler

SYNOPSIS

       theme-d-compile [ OPTION ] ...  FILE

DESCRIPTION

       Compile  the  Theme-D source file FILE to Theme-D pseudocode. The default output file name is obtained by
       replacing the suffix of the source file as follows:

       thp => tcp

       ths => tcs

       thi => tci

       thb => tcb

       By default, the output file is placed into the directory where the command theme-d-compile is invoked.

OPTIONS

       -o, --output=OUTPUTFILE
              Specify the compilation output file.

       -m, --module-path=PATH
              Specify the search path for Theme-D modules. The path should be a list  of  directories  separated
              with  :'s.  You  can  prefix the list with a colon in order to include the default Theme-D library
              path in the search path.

       -u, --unit-type=TYPE
              Specify the type of the unit to be compiled. The unit  type  has  to  be  one  of  proper-program,
              script, interface, or body.

       -l, --message-level=LEVEL
              Specify  the  message  level  of  the compiler. The level has to be an integer number from 0 to 3.
              Value 0 means no output and value 3 the most verbose output.

       --expand-only
              Do only macro expansion on the source.

       --no-expansion
              Compile the source without macro expansion.

       --backtrace
              Print backtrace on compilation error.

       --pretty-print
              Pretty print the pseudocode output.

       --no-verbose-errors
              Less information in the error messages.

       --show-modules
              Show information about loading modules.

ENVIRONMENT

       THEME_D_CONFIG_FILE
              If this variable is defined its value is used as the Theme-D configuration  file  instead  of  the
              default configuration file.

FILES

       /etc/theme-d-config
              The Theme-D configuration file.

       ~/.theme-d-config
              The  Theme-D  configuration  file. This file should be normally present only if you use Theme-D in
              local mode.
